workqueue: Remove unneeded lockdep_assert_cpus_held()



The commit 19af4575 ("workqueue: Remove cpus_read_lock() from
apply_wqattrs_lock()") removes the unneed cpus_read_lock() after the pwq
creations and installations have been reworked based on wq_online_cpumask
rather than cpu_online_mask making cpus_read_lock() is unneeded during
wqattrs changes.

But it desn't remove the lockdep_assert_cpus_held() checks during wqattrs
changes, which leads to complaints from lockdep reported by kernel test
robot:

Fix it by removing the unneeded lockdep_assert_cpus_held().
Also remove the unneed cpus_read_lock() from wq_affn_dfl_set().

tj: Dropped the removal of cpus_read_lock/unlock() in wq_affn_dfl_set() to
    keep this patch fix only.
